Transaction 51a7aff643491621d144680857efaad128bf41654d81a1cdbe068ca982456e13
1 Input
2 Outputs
- 51a7aff643491621d144680857efaad128bf41654d81a1cdbe068ca982456e13:0
- 51a7aff643491621d144680857efaad128bf41654d81a1cdbe068ca982456e13:1
value 510000
address 12LrqzhxfzVdm8XEzGzPoRcuoRBwBtiQYz
value 426977
address 1B29YSyKDX7REHAxWFpTu7bzFmmKUAkfxX